Abstract

We give in this paper a modified self-dual action that leads to the SO (3) ADM formalism without having to face the difficult second-class constraints present in other approaches (for example, if the starting point is the Hilbert-Palatini action). We use the new action principle to gain some new insight into the problem of the reality conditions that must be imposed in order to get real formulations from complex general relativity. We derive also a real formulation for Lorentzian general relativity in the Ashtekar phase space by using the modified action presented in the paper.
